Transaction 29083e3a21cbc06ae34e12a7dd1d176358aef90e17956e578cae0d41e7676458
1 Input
1 Output
-
29083e3a21cbc06ae34e12a7dd1d176358aef90e17956e578cae0d41e7676458:0
- value
- 153600
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ff9eec6302660ebebc522e870ad31105de795ecf
- address
- bc1ql70wccczvc8ta0zj96rs45c3qh08jhk0846u8s